在 ADFv2 中,表达式允许通过 @activity('ActivityName')
引用事件,这可用于获取输出或错误。是否可以在不知道或在表达式中编码名称的情况下获取对先前事件的引用?
最佳答案
Is it possible to get a reference to the previous activity without knowing or coding the name in the expression?
据我所知,ADF 中没有这样的功能。我尝试在这里提供一个属性供您引用,您可以使用:DependsOn
。这个属性描述了组件之间的依赖关系。如果多个事件是由不同状态的先前事件引起的,它将被构造成一个数组。
但不是在表达式中使用,可以在sdk中获取和设置。您可以引用此案例的一些片段 ( Python Azure Data Factory Update Pipeline ),尤其是 ActivityDependency
。
关于azure-data-factory-2 - 引用以前的事件但不命名,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/58896347/